The Museum of Islamic Art is a museum in Cairo, Egypt. It is considered one of the greatest museums in the world, with its exceptional collection of rare woodwork and plaster artefacts, as well as metal, ceramic, glass, crystal, and textile objects of all periods, from all over the Islamic world. Bab Zuwayla or Bab Zuweila is one of three remaining gates in the city walls of historic Cairo in Egypt. It was also known as Bawabat al-Mitwali or Bab al-Mitwali. Bāb Zuwaylah is situated 310 metres east of Mosque of Fatima Shaqra.

The Mosque of Sultan al-Mu'ayyad, is a mosque on al-Mu'izz Street, adjacent to Bab Zuwayla, in Islamic Cairo, Egypt. The complex was built between 1415 and 1421, under the rule of the Mamluk sultan al-Mu'ayyad Shaykh, from whom it takes its name. jāmi‘ al-Muʼayyad Shaykh is situated 270 metres east of Mosque of Fatima Shaqra.

Bab al-Louq is a neighborhood in downtown Cairo. The Egyptian Ministry of Interior was formerly located there. Bab al-Louq square is the oldest square in Cairo, dating back to the Mamluk era.
